Output 1688b16e12da06d3bc53f1091e1d456e63628faf86a6f181b07421fe5562d670:57

value
38397014
script pubkey
OP_0 OP_PUSHBYTES_20 f107b91a88f179220004f17b658ead0131b75bec
address
ltc1q7yrmjx5g79ujyqqy79aktr4dqycmwklvv2qv70
transaction
1688b16e12da06d3bc53f1091e1d456e63628faf86a6f181b07421fe5562d670
spent
true